    How to make this jalapeno cheese crisps recipe

    Preheat the oven to 400 degrees

    On a baking sheet, sprinkle a generous pinch of shredded cheddar cheese, about 3” apart.

    For easier cleanup, you can line the baking tray with parchment paper.

    I like sharp cheddar for this recipe, but medium cheddar works as well.

    shredded cheese on a pan

    Slice the jalapeno into thin slices.

    On top of each of the piles of cheese, drop one of your jalapeno slices.

    Feel free to sprinkle some parmesan cheese on top prior to popping these in the oven.

    shredded cheese and jalapeno

    Bake at 400 degrees for 6 to 9 minutes, until the edges of the keto cheese chips look crispy.

    jalapeno cheese crisps

    Allow to cool for 5 minutes, then enjoy your jalapeño cheese crisps!

    cheese crisps

    These are great to dip in salsa or guacamole, top a salad or a burger, crumble on a soup, or just enjoy on their own! If you like these, be sure to try Loaded Bacon Cheddar Cheese Chips from The Little Pine.

    Frequently asked questions

    Can I use any other kind of cheese to make keto cheese crisps?

    You can use other types of shredded cheese such as mozzarella, colby or pepper jack for a little added spice.

    Can I make these in the microwave?

    No, the crispness will not be the same.

    How do I store these low carb cheese chips?

    You can store them at room temperature in an airtight container for 2-3 days. Do not store in the fridge.
